Q: Is 721,435 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 721,435 is not a prime number.

Why is 721,435 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 721435 can be evenly divided by 1 5 11 13 55 65 143 715 1,009 5,045 11,099 13,117 55,495 65,585 144,287 and 721,435, with no remainder.

Since 721,435 cannot be divided by just 1 and 721,435, it is not a prime number.
